Excerpt from Juvenile Instructor, Vol. 38: October 15, 1903 Jewish traditions relate that the start ing of the caravan for Palestine was extremely joyous. Zerubbabel and Joshua, the high priest, and ten other leaders, marshalled the company in twelve divisions. An escort oi ten thousand cavalry accompanied them across the desert to protect them against the prowling Arabs. The rich rode horses; the aged, the children, and delicate women rode camels; but the fact that there were only beasts of carriage to people shows that most Of the caravan marched on foot. In the front, where the ark of the covenant was carried in the first ex odus, were carried the sacred vessels of the temple.
